Output 3430a5d1dcefaeb81e32a170c70fc7b6cf80c720df18d5214d81eb01e71706f4:1

value
456649
script pubkey
OP_0 OP_PUSHBYTES_20 143f76846f85707ac1a2824fed9020ea64ebd086
address
bc1qzslhdpr0s4c84sdzsf87mypqafjwh5yxdp5uc3
transaction
3430a5d1dcefaeb81e32a170c70fc7b6cf80c720df18d5214d81eb01e71706f4
spent
true